A-1 Skyraider "Lieutenant America" — Cockpit and Nose Art Detail with Pilot

A-1 Skyraider "Lieutenant America" — Cockpit and Nose Art Detail with Pilot

The Douglas A-1 Skyraider, nicknamed "Spad" or "Sandy" by its crews, served as a rugged close-air-support and search-and-rescue escort aircraft throughout the Vietnam War. This preserved example, nose-named "Lieutenant America," is shown here with a pilot in the cockpit, helmet and flight suit visible, evoking the aircraft's operational heyday supporting downed-airman rescue missions.
